diff --git a/app/src/Peer.js b/app/src/Peer.js index 8aeea12c..b0f6982e 100644 --- a/app/src/Peer.js +++ b/app/src/Peer.js @@ -25,13 +25,16 @@ module.exports = class Peer { case 'audio': case 'audioType': this.peer_info.peer_audio = data.status; + this.peer_audio = data.status; break; case 'video': case 'videoType': this.peer_info.peer_video = data.status; + this.peer_video = data.status; break; case 'hand': this.peer_info.peer_hand = data.status; + this.peer_hand = data.status; break; } } diff --git a/app/src/Server.js b/app/src/Server.js index a75ce65b..54ef2dc7 100644 --- a/app/src/Server.js +++ b/app/src/Server.js @@ -666,7 +666,7 @@ io.on('connection', (socket) => { log.debug('Producer close', data); - // peer_info audio Or video ON + // peer_info audio Or video OFF roomList.get(socket.room_id).getPeers().get(socket.id).updatePeerInfo(data); roomList.get(socket.room_id).closeProducer(socket.id, data.producer_id); });